I don't know too much about Papa Levi, but I love this single. It's a reggae cover of the 'Georgie Fame' classic 'Bonnie and Clyde. I first heard this version played on a John Peel session, and as soon as it was released it was a must buy.
I've mentioned before I'm a fan of covers especially when they are done differently and this one clearly is. The b-side 'Warning' is all about avoiding catching 'Herpes' lovely topic, but then again it does make sense.
